Climate
Winter in San Francisco is rainy
and mild, spring sunny and temperate, summer foggy and cool, and autumn sunny
and warm. The average minimum temperature is51 °F (11 °C), and the average
maximum is 63 °F
(17 °C).
The mean rainfall, almost all of which occurs between November and April, is
about 21 inches (533 mm). There is sunshine
during two-thirds of the possible daylight hours. The most characteristic feature
of the weather, however, is the summer fog, which lies low over the city until
midday, creating consternation among shivering tourists. This fog is a phenomenon
of temperature contrasts, created when warm, moist ocean air comes in contact
with cold water welling up from the ocean bottom along the coast.
